Are the bikes water-proof? minus plus

The bikes are not water-proof, they are water-resistant. While we do not recommend leaving the bikes out in the rain or riding in the rain or other hazardous conditions due to personal safety, the bikes can handle low pressure exposure to water. Do not submerge in water or expose to pressurized air or water. Storing your ebike in the elements could shorten the lifespan of the electric bike.

What Is a Moped-style eBike? minus plus

The difference between an ebike and a moped-style ebike is all in design and top speed. Typically, moped electric bikes have programming and motor capabilities that allow for a higher top speed than class 3 ebike regulations allow. This is more than 28 mph, but designed for private property and technically not legal to ride on public roads at these speeds. Additionally, moped-style electric bikes are typically designed with wide tires, classic moto-inspired styling and have a retro look, akin to cafe racer motorcycles.

Our Revv1, available in Graphite Gray and Moss Green, is pre-programmed as a Class 2 e-bike, so you can ride most anywhere at twenty miles-per-hour with throttle and pedal assist. However, you can unlock the programming to reach speeds north of 28 mph. This is intended for private property only.

What Is the Difference Between a Moped eBike and Electric Moped? minus plus

A regular electric moped works on a twist-and-go basis. Akin to a motorcycle, they do not have pedals, require insurance and registration and are heavier than an electric bike because of a larger battery and frame build. An electric moped ebike incorporates a motor, does not require insurance or registration and has pedals so in theory, the rider is intended to power the bike by pedaling. This design bypasses the regulatory needs of a moped, has a smaller, lighter battery and incorporates an element of exercise that you do not get with an electric moped or electric motorcycle.

  1. Phill

    I am really happy with my REVV1 DRT. This bike has almost everything that I was looking for. I like the speed, range, looks, and comfort. the battery takes me over 30 miles in one charge with an average speed of 20PMH. That range isn’t enough for me so I’m planning to buy a second battery witch I will allow me to ride about 4 hours in all. The brake rotors do rub a little and it’s hard to align them. The throttle is falling behind, once I twist it, there is a delay before it starts going, and when letting go of throttle, the motor keeps spinning for like half a second. I also have to admire the suspension for how soft it is, it has to be one of the best suspensions on all ebikes. The average top speed I got within every ride was around 34MPH. I’m also glad that I can switch the bikes settings to class 2 which will make it legal to ride on roads. The customer service is very well and respond very quickly. The bike looks really good, and the seat is comfortable which is good for long rides. Overall, this bike has to be one of the best in the market for the price.

  2. Dan

    I have had my bike for a few months now, and just hit my first 150 miles. Pros, it looks badass, gets lots of compliments, and the suspension is really cushy. The ride feels smooth like a motorcycle, and has great handling. The headlight is pretty good, charging is easy, and overall- great build quality (doesn’t feel cheap, and has nice parts). My cons are that it could use a better kickstand, the bike is heavy (~95 pounds) and the kickstand has failed a few times.. the throttle acceleration, for an ebike with pedals is amazing, but sometimes going up steep hills or off-road trails, I find myself craving a bit more power/acceleration- But I understand it’s a moped-style ebike not an electric dirt bike. This bike is basically the nicest thing you can buy at $2500 before going into that next category of off-road bikes ($3000+).
    In conclusion, this is an awesome bike that will turn some heads and get you around town, as well as on some back roads & trails at playful speeds- The top speed is fun (about 35 mph unlocked) much faster and it gets too dangerous for me anyways, especially off-road. Though, I wish it could get up to that 35 mph a bit faster, but for the price, it’s pretty damn zippy. But do keep in mind, as the power percentage drains, it gets slower/less acceleration, so you first 5-10 miles on a fresh charge are going to be the most fun/zippy.

    If you’re reading this review to decide whether or not to buy it, I’d say go for it- gets me out of the house way more often, and inspired me to build a back yard trail, and just brings a lot of joy. It’s a bit pricey, but it rips.
